Why is clonidine sometimes a good choice as an antihypertensive?
It decreases systolic BP moreso than diastolic
BUT
Doesn’t impact homeostatic reflexes, so orthostatic hypotension and exercise induced hypotension can be avoided
What are the most common side effects of clonidine?
sedation
xerostomia
The two major physiologic mechanisms that cause ectopic cardiac arrhythmias are:
Reentry
Enhanced Automaticity
Why do people tend to go into VFib during stress states?
SNS activity lowers the threshold for ventricular fibrillation
